Output 89a31d8fe33cf933883414df128af80d466c3b2939e69bc43e18c46cc0ec551f:0

value
1188898
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 afa8b168aeddafc853793199f8620b0113b4f97a OP_EQUALVERIFY OP_CHECKSIG
address
1H1oLZozyvN6teqLChFaDSTtNkK15FEkww
transaction
89a31d8fe33cf933883414df128af80d466c3b2939e69bc43e18c46cc0ec551f
spent
true